need advice ASAP new injector seals leaking!!!
I installed the cam tower and I resealed the injectors using the pelican parts kit. I used new O-rings on both ends but used the same washer. When I try the spacer that came with the kit it doesn't look right. The hat doesn't sit all the way down on the injector. It seems like the injector O-ring isn't going all the way into the intake manifold hole even though I push like a motha.
Advice please. I need this assembled before dark. Thanks, Speedy

Did you lube up the O-rings?
New ones are a tight fit, but they will go in with some effort. Silicone lube, ATF, or vaseline work well. The new spacer will be a little "crooked" that is normal. Everything lines up when you press it all in. AFJ
